On Thursday, July 26, 2001, at 02:08 , Abigail wrote:

> I believe that it produced the right results on the inputs you tested
> it with. But can you proof your trick will always sort the array?

Proof? No. Actually, given the list I used for input, only six 
iterations of the for loop were required to sort.

> I doubt very much that this is a fair shuffle. See, for a fair shuffle
> each of the @list! possible permutations should have the same chance
> of resulting. And, under the assumption 'rand' is perfect', I don't see
> your shuffle doing that.

I don't believe it's a fair shuffle, either. For better or 
worse, fairness and accuracy weren't part of my design goals. :-)

--
Craig S. Cottingham
[EMAIL PROTECTED]
PGP key available from: 
<http://pgp.ai.mit.edu:11371/pks/lookup?op=get&search=0xA2FFBE41>
ID=0xA2FFBE41, fingerprint=6AA8 2E28 2404 8A95 B8FC 7EFC 136F 
0CEF A2FF BE41

Reply via email to